Seed germination device for butterfly orchid tissue culture Technical Field The utility model relates to the technical field of butterfly orchid tissue culture, in particular to a seed germination device for butterfly orchid tissue culture. Background The butterfly orchid belongs to single-stem aerial orchid, few development side branches are developed, conventional asexual propagation is difficult to carry out, such as the propagation coefficient of a separated plant is extremely low, pollination cannot be completed under natural conditions, seeds are difficult to obtain even if artificial pollination is carried out, endosperm is not contained in the seeds, germination is difficult to occur under natural conditions, germination rate is extremely low, sexual propagation is difficult to carry out by utilizing the seeds, a large number of high-quality and regular butterfly orchid young plants can be obtained in a short period by tissue culture, and the butterfly orchid seedling culture method has the advantages of high proliferation rate, high speed, no season limitation, annual production, easiness in virus removal and the like, and is a high-efficiency way for industrial propagation. However, the conventional device has the following problems: 1. The existing device mainly comprises the steps of directly placing seeds on the device to germinate the seeds, so that the seeds need to be pulled out of the germination device after the germination of the seeds is completed, and the survival rate of the seeds is affected. 2. Meanwhile, part of devices are not arranged on the device for uniformly humidifying the seeds, so that the seeds germinate at a speed and affected germination caused by different humidity in the germination process of the seeds. Therefore, in order to solve the above problems, a seed germination apparatus for butterfly orchid tissue culture is proposed.
